What they do
A Construction Safety Manager is responsible for ensuring compliance with all construction safety matters, legislative and regulatory, relating to a construction organization's day to day operations. Will provide specialist advice to the management and employees of the organization. May organize training to improve employee understanding of best construction safety practice.
